Shadscale , Salt Bush
Atriplex confertifolia

Chenopodiaceae

Gray, ovate to circular leaves with a strong fish-like scent; flowers in spikes.

Plant Form or Habit: upright

Plant Type: perennial

Plant Use: beds & borders natives

Propagation: division stem cuttings

Light Requirement: medium

Flower Color: silver, white

Blooming Period: summer

Height: 3 '

Width: 3'

Foliage Texture: medium

Heat Tolerance: high

Water Requirements: low

Additional Comments: Used for naturalistic landscapes; tolerant of seashore conditions or highly alkaline soil.
